你有没有遇到过这种情况?辛辛苦苦准备了一笔以太坊交易,结果发送出去后,却一直处于待处理状态,仿佛被网络遗忘了一般。别急,今天就来和你聊聊这个让人头疼的问题——以太坊发送交易失败,让我们一起揭开它的神秘面纱。
一、交易失败的原因

1. Gas 费设置过低

以太坊的交易费用由两部分组成:基础费用和优先级费用。Gas 费设置过低,意味着你的交易在众多交易中优先级不高,自然容易被网络遗忘。
2. 网络拥堵

以太坊网络拥堵时,交易处理速度会变慢,导致交易长时间处于待处理状态。
3. 钱包问题
钱包故障或设置错误也可能导致交易失败。
二、应对策略
1. 提高 Gas 费
如果你确定交易内容无误,可以尝试提高 Gas 费。具体操作如下:
- 使用具有交易管理功能的钱包,如 MetaMask,在待处理交易中找到“加速”选项,输入更高的 Gas 费用。
- 手动替换交易,通过提交具有相同随机数和更高 Gas 费用的新交易来取消卡住的交易。
2. 等待网络拥堵缓解
如果网络拥堵导致交易失败,可以等待一段时间,让网络拥堵缓解后再尝试发送交易。
3. 检查钱包设置
确保你的钱包设置正确,没有故障。
三、预防措施
1. 选择合适的 Gas 费
在发送交易前,根据当前网络活动选择合适的 Gas 费用。许多钱包都会根据当前网络活动提供建议的 Gas 费用,你可以参考这些建议。
2. 关注网络拥堵情况
在发送交易前,关注网络拥堵情况,避免在拥堵时段发送交易。
3. 备份钱包
定期备份你的钱包,以防万一。
四、案例分析
小王在发送以太坊交易时,由于 Gas 费设置过低,导致交易长时间处于待处理状态。后来,他提高了 Gas 费,并等待网络拥堵缓解后,交易终于成功完成。
五、
以太坊发送交易失败是一个让人头疼的问题,但只要掌握正确的方法,就能轻松应对。希望这篇文章能帮助你解决这个难题,让你的以太坊交易更加顺利!